## Production SFTP posture (this box: manual mode)
|
||||
|
||||
This host runs in **manual SFTP mode** against Gainwell's MOVEit Transfer MFT at `mft.gainwelltechnologies.com`. The seeded `dzinesco` clearhouse keeps `sftp_block.stub: true`; the operator moves files to/from Gainwell with their SFTP client and drops inbound files into `ingest/` for cyclone to ingest. Do NOT flip `stub` to `false` from this host — see "Auth caveat" below.
|
||||
|
||||
### Env var convention
|
||||
|
||||
The operator's shell exports the Gainwell creds as `GAINWELL_SFTP_USER`, `GAINWELL_SFTP_PASS`, `GAINWELL_SFTP_HOST`, `GAINWELL_REMOTE_DIR`. Cyclone's `secrets.get_secret()` looks up `CYCLONE_SFTP_PASSWORD` (or `CYCLONE_SFTP_PASSWORD_FILE`) per `secrets._ENV_NAME_FOR`. The two are NOT the same name — bridge them per-call or in your shell rc: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
export CYCLONE_SFTP_PASSWORD="$GAINWELL_SFTP_PASS"
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Inbound drop zone
|
||||
|
||||
`/home/tyler/dev/cyclone/ingest/` is the operator-maintained staging dir for inbound MFT files (999 acks, TA1, 835 remittances, 277CA claim acks). Files here are NOT auto-watched; processing happens via the procedure in `docs/RUNBOOK.md` § "Manual SFTP mode". At time of writing this dir holds ~1500 unprocessed 999 acks + 1 TA1 + 1 835 from early July 2026 — the local ingest flow clears them.
|
||||
|
||||
### Auth caveat (do not retry)
|
||||
|
||||
Paramiko reaches `MOVEit Transfer SFTP` cleanly (SSH kex completes, MOVEit offers password auth) but `AuthenticationException: Authentication failed` is returned despite the operator confirming the credentials are known-good from another host. Most likely cause: MOVEit Transfer's IP-based access control — this host's public IP `103.14.26.95` is not whitelisted. Repeated auth attempts risk account lockout. Do NOT keep guessing. Resolve by either: (a) whitelisting this IP with Gainwell's MFT admin, or (b) staying in manual mode and moving files via the operator's SFTP client.
|
||||
|
||||
### Inbound ingestion paths
|
||||
|
||||
The canonical way to write 999/TA1/277CA/835 rows into the DB is `Scheduler.process_inbound_files`, exposed as the CLI `cyclone pull-inbound --date YYYYMMDD` and the HTTP `POST /api/admin/scheduler/pull-inbound`. **There is no `parse-999` / `parse-ta1` / `parse-277ca` CLI command** (CLAUDE.md's "CLI" section above is aspirational on those three). The `parse-837` and `parse-835` CLIs exist but only emit JSON files to `--output-dir`; they do NOT write to the DB. For DB writes, use `pull-inbound` (which dedupes via `processed_inbound_files`).
|
||||
|
||||
### Daemon hot-reload
|
||||
|
||||
`python -m cyclone serve` runs as root (started by `tini`) and keeps the SFTP block in memory. Flipping `stub` directly in the DB (`store.update_clearhouse(...)`) does NOT auto-reload the daemon's view — either restart the daemon or use `PATCH /api/clearhouse` (which calls `scheduler.reconfigure_scheduler` to hot-reload).

## Manual SFTP mode (this box's current posture)
|
||||
|
||||
Use this when the host's IP isn't whitelisted with Gainwell's MFT, when
|
||||
you don't want a daemon polling every minute, or when you prefer to
|
||||
drag-drop files with FileZilla / WinSCP. The seeded `dzinesco`
|
||||
clearhouse ships in this mode (`sftp_block.stub: true`); no daemon
|
||||
changes required.
|
||||
|
||||
**Posture.** `SftpClient` reads/writes to local staging instead of
|
||||
`mft.gainwelltechnologies.com`:
|
||||
|
||||
- Outbound (`write_file`): `./var/sftp/staging/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/ToHPE/`
|
||||
- Inbound (`list_inbound`): `./var/sftp/staging/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/FromHPE/`
|
||||
|
||||
(Paths are relative to the backend cwd; create the directories if
|
||||
absent.)
|
||||
|
||||
### Daily flow (manual mode)
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Pull inbound from Gainwell** with your SFTP client:
|
||||
`/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/FromHPE/`
|
||||
2. **Stage locally** in `./var/sftp/staging/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/FromHPE/`
|
||||
(or, equivalently, drop them in `/home/tyler/dev/cyclone/ingest/`
|
||||
and copy in).
|
||||
3. **Process** with `pull-inbound` (writes acks/835s to DB, dedupes
|
||||
via `processed_inbound_files`):
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
cd /home/tyler/dev/cyclone/backend
|
||||
mkdir -p "./var/sftp/staging/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/FromHPE"
|
||||
cp /home/tyler/dev/cyclone/ingest/*.x12 \
|
||||
"./var/sftp/staging/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/FromHPE/"
|
||||
.venv/bin/python -m cyclone pull-inbound --date 20260701
|
||||
.venv/bin/python -m cyclone pull-inbound --date 20260702
|
||||
.venv/bin/python -m cyclone pull-inbound --date 20260703
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
4. **Submit outbound** with `POST /api/clearhouse/submit` (writes
|
||||
serialized 837P files into the stub staging dir; you drag-drop
|
||||
them to your SFTP client's `/CO XIX/PROD/coxix_prod_11525703/ToHPE/`).
|
||||
|
||||
### Backfill a backlog
|
||||
|
||||
`ingest/` often holds days of unprocessed acks. The copy + per-date
|
||||
`pull-inbound` flow above clears it. Files already in
|
||||
`processed_inbound_files` are skipped automatically — to re-process,
|
||||
delete the row first (`DELETE FROM processed_inbound_files WHERE name = ...`).
|
||||
|
||||
### Note on per-file parse CLIs
|
||||
|
||||
`parse-837` and `parse-835` exist as CLIs but only emit JSON files to
|
||||
`--output-dir`; they do NOT write to the DB. There is no
|
||||
`parse-999` / `parse-ta1` / `parse-277ca` CLI in this version of
|
||||
cyclone — the canonical 999/TA1/277CA/835 ingestion path is
|
||||
`pull-inbound` → `Scheduler.process_inbound_files`. For inspection of
|
||||
a single file without DB writes, use the Python API:
|
||||
|
||||
```python
|
||||
from cyclone.parsers.parse_999 import parse as parse_999
|
||||
result = parse_999(open("path.999.x12").read())
|
||||
```
|
||||
